The Schneider Electric 140CPU43412C is a high-performance programmable logic controller (PLC) from the Modicon M340 series, designed for applications requiring powerful processing and scalability in industrial automation. Equipped with a 32-bit processor and a robust memory capacity, the 140CPU43412C is optimized for handling complex control tasks and large-scale automation processes in a wide range of industries. The controller is part of a modular system, allowing easy integration with other automation components and offering expandability through additional I/O modules.
With support for multiple communication protocols, including Modbus TCP, Modbus RTU, and CANopen, the 140CPU43412C can seamlessly integrate into existing control systems, making it suitable for manufacturing, energy management, water treatment, and more. Its flexibility and scalability allow it to be adapted for both small and large systems, ensuring a tailored solution for diverse industrial needs.
The 140CPU43412C is a versatile PLC suitable for a variety of industrial applications. Below are some of the key applications where it excels:
Manufacturing Automation: This PLC is used extensively in automated production lines, robotic cells, conveyor systems, and other industrial machinery. It offers precise control, monitoring, and real-time data processing to optimize production efficiency and reduce downtime.
Energy and Utilities Management: In energy control systems, the 140CPU43412C helps manage power distribution, monitor energy consumption, and ensure the optimization of energy usage across industrial facilities.
Water and Wastewater Treatment: The PLC plays a critical role in automating the processes involved in water filtration, chemical dosing, pumping stations, and other operations in water treatment and wastewater management.
Building Automation: The 140CPU43412C is widely used in building automation systems, where it helps control HVAC, lighting, access control, and other systems to ensure energy efficiency and operational reliability.
Transportation and Infrastructure: The PLC is utilized in traffic management systems, toll systems, and public transportation infrastructure to ensure seamless operation and enhance system safety.
High-Speed Data Processing: The 140CPU43412C features a 32-bit processor and a large memory capacity, allowing it to handle complex control algorithms and manage large quantities of data with speed and accuracy.
Flexible Communication Options: The PLC supports multiple communication protocols, such as Modbus TCP, Modbus RTU, and CANopen, enabling easy integration with various devices and systems across industrial environments.
Scalable and Modular: With a modular design, the 140CPU43412C can be expanded by adding I/O modules, communication cards, and other components, making it highly adaptable to changing system requirements.
Reliability and Durability: Designed for industrial environments, the 140CPU43412C offers high reliability and durability, ensuring stable operation in harsh conditions while minimizing the risk of system downtime.
Compact Design: Despite offering powerful functionality, the 140CPU43412C has a compact form factor, saving valuable space in control cabinets while delivering high performance.
Energy-Efficient: The system is designed to optimize energy usage in industrial applications, contributing to overall cost savings and improved energy efficiency.
